VIDEO: Vettel SOAKS Monaco royal family in champagne

Sebastian Vettel is accustomed to spraying champagned on the Monaco Grand Prix podium, so you would think his aim would be a bit better than this. Prince Albert and Princess Charlene were in the firing line as the Ferrari man commemorated Daniel Ricciardo's Monte Carlo win! The princess was later treated to a taste of bubbly by the Australian, but didn't seem too keen...
